![]() file defined by the file input stream. This option must be followed by the name of the tar file. f: File, the name of the tar file we want tar to work with. z: Gzip, use gzip to decompress the tar file. v: Verbose, list the files as they are being extracted. This video is the part 1 where I have showed how to unzip a. The command line options we used are: -x: Extract, retrieve the files from the tar file. ![]() Create a gzip input stream to decompress the source Here are two methods: one that unzips a file and another one that untars it. Since the application runs in a linux environment, I figured I'd try using unix commands like 'mount' and 'tar'. Create a file input stream to read the source file.įileInputStream fis = new FileInputStream(sourceFile) I'm currently working on a web application that involves mounting a drive and extracting a tar.gz file, all in Java. While GZipOutputStream was used to create the gzip file, the GZipInputStream is the class that handles the decompression. ![]() OPTIONAL: Click blue Preview button to open directly in the browser. Click the green Save button on the individual files to save to your local drive. It means to create a file without saving it into the local disk and put the file into the tar.gz directly. Just like the previous example, we are also going to use the FileInputStream and FileOutputStream class to read the compressed source file and to write out the decompressed file. To select the tar.gz file, you have two options: Click Select tar.gz file to open to open the file chooser. This example adds String into a ByteArrayInputStream and put it into the TarArchiveOutputStream directly. Write a program to unzip or decompress the contents of zip file using ZipInputStream in java. To get the file back to its original version we will now learn how to decompress the gzip file. Given a zipped or compressed file in java. When extracting files, the Jar tool makes copies of the desired files and writes them to the current directory, reproducing the directory structure that the. ![]() In the previous example we have learn how to compress a file in GZIP format.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|